Xcelium 1803 IE Card Config for Multi Power Supply

SpiceMonkey
SpiceMonkey 3 months ago

IE Card configuration only makes effect on hierarchy of level 1, if hierarchy level is over 2, IE Card configuration would behave unexpectedly

  1. CASE1, there are 2 instances in TB, I0(cell1) and I1(cell2), simulator successfully convert logic High to 1.8 and 2.0;
  2. CASE2, there is 1 instance in TB, I0, and 2 instances inside the I0, I0/I0(cell3) and I0/I1(cell4), In this case, the simulator converts all logic levels to the global 3V, rather than 1.8V or 2.0V as expected.

I tested CASE 2 using a newer version of Xcelium, and it worked as expected. However, due to project constraints, I must use Xcelium 18.03. Is there any additional configuration or workaround that can make it behave correctly in this version?
